Top Universities in the UK for Artificial Intelligence

The United Kingdom is home to some of the world’s leading universities that are shaping the future of Artificial Intelligence. These institutions not only deliver world-class education but also drive cutting-edge research in AI, machine learning, and data science.

Features

  • Universities like Oxford, Cambridge, Imperial College London, and University College London rank among the global leaders in AI.

  • The University of Edinburgh and The University of Manchester are recognized for their AI research hubs.

  • Specialized institutions such as the London School of Economics (LSE) and King’s College London also contribute significantly to applied AI studies.

Other notable names include University of Bristol, University of Glasgow, University of Leeds, Durham University, and Queen’s University Belfast. These institutions collaborate with industries to produce AI solutions for healthcare, finance, robotics, and cybersecurity.

From London to Edinburgh, Manchester to Belfast, UK universities are powering the AI revolution with innovative courses and advanced research centers. Choosing one of these universities means stepping into a future of opportunities in artificial intelligence.
